Category-wise expected cutoff (indicative)

CategoryExpected Cutoff (indicative)
General (UR)55-65 marks out of 100
EWS52-62 marks out of 100
OBC-NCL48-58 marks out of 100
SC42-52 marks out of 100
ST38-48 marks out of 100
PwD (UR)38-48 marks out of 100
PwD (OBC)35-45 marks out of 100
PwD (SC/ST)32-42 marks out of 100
  • The typical gap between General and OBC cutoffs ranges 7-10 marks, while SC/ST cutoffs are typically 12-18 marks below General category cutoffs.
  • Cutoffs fluctuate based on vacancy numbers, total applicants, exam difficulty level, and zonal variations (different RRBs may have slightly different cutoffs based on regional competition).
  • ExServicemen and other special categories typically follow their parent category cutoff with minor relaxations; actual selection depends on normalization scores across multiple exam sessions and PET/document verification clearance.
